Oracle SQL Connector

 Overview 

Oracle SQL is a widely used relational database management system designed for enterprise environments across industries such as finance, healthcare, and retail.

The Oracle SQL connector allows you to read, write, and synchronize data from your Oracle SQL database directly within Zoho Creator, without exposing it to the public internet. Connectivity is handled securely through Databridge, a lightweight agent installed inside your network.

Setting up Oracle SQL connector 

To connect Zoho Creator with your Oracle SQL database, follow the steps given below:

  1. In Zoho Creator, go to Operations -> DataBridge. From the list displayed, select the operating system and version that matches your host machine (for example, macOS - 64 bit). The Databridge package will be downloaded as a zip file.



  2. Install Databridge on the host machine where your Oracle SQL database is accessible. Once installed, start Databridge.

  3. With Databridge running, you're ready to connect Oracle SQL to Zoho Creator. In Zoho Creator, go to Operations -> Databridge and confirm that Databridge shows a status of Active.

  4. Once Databridge is active, click Add Connection and select the Oracle database connector.

     

  5. In the Add Connection pane, your databridge is automatically selected. Fill in the remaining details to complete the required configurations and click Create and Authorize.



  6. When the Link Account popup appears, provide the following details: username, password, host, port, and database name. Click Authorize to complete the connection.



For detailed instructions, see Configuring Databridge help doc.
